F5 released its Quarterly Security Notification, addressing multiple security flaws across its product ecosystem. While F5 classifies the primary vulnerabilities as >>Medium<< severity under their internal policy, the updated CVSS v4.0 scoring system assigns them a score of 8.2, indicating a high risk to enterprise environments.
